The Role
This is a hands-on leadership role where you’ll be expected to lead from the front and support both people and systems.
Key responsibilities include:
Supporting the Registered Manager with the day-to-day running of the service
Acting as Manager on Duty when required
Managing and maintaining staff rotas, ensuring safe staffing levels and appropriate skill mix
Supporting recruitment, including shortlisting, interviews, onboarding, and induction
Ensuring care plans, risk assessments, and daily records are reviewed, accurate, current, and person-centred
Leading on incident reporting, learning, and follow-up actions
Promoting a positive, respectful, and accountable team culture
Supporting CQC compliance, audits, and inspections
Building effective relationships with families and professionals
